Medicare costs aren't one-size-fits-all. What you pay depends on a few moving parts, mainly where you live, the specific plan type you choose, and your personal health needs. Some plans have lower monthly premiums but higher out-of-pocket costs when you see a doctor, while others flip that dynamic. Your eligibility for extra assistance or state programs also plays a significant role in lowering your monthly expenses. Your Medicare number is the unique identification code found on your red, white, and blue Medicare card. This number is used by healthcare providers to process your claims and coordinate your benefits. You should keep this number secure and only share it with trusted medical providers. Medicare Secondary Payer (MSP) rules in Berkeley mean that if you have other insurance that's primary, like from an employer, that insurance pays first. Medicare pays second. Medicare Part C in Berkeley is known as Medicare Advantage. These are health plan options approved by Medicare and run by private insurance companies. Eligibility for Medicare in Berkeley generally depends on age (65 or older) or disability status. You must be a U.S. citizen or have been a legal resident for at least five years.
